Harry Lapow (February 6, 1909—September 14, 1982, 14 September) was an American photographer.
Career
Lapow studied with Lisette Model and Sid Grossman and for over 25 years he took photographs of Coney Island.
Recognition
One of Lapow's early photographs of an Italian wedding on the beach at Coney Island was selected by Edward Steichen for The Family of Manexhibition at the Museum of Modern Art, that toured the world and was seen by 9 million visitors.
Legacy
Daughter Marcelle Lapow Toor is the executor for Lapow's estate and maintains his archive.
